Overview

Varony is a small village in Belarus. Varony maps to 55.150°, 30.394° — squarely within the cool temperate belt. Recent open-data figures place its population at about 679. The latitude suggests long cool seasons and short, mild summers. Open solar datasets indicate about 1,045 kWh/m² of solar irradiance per year, combined with sunshine for roughly 41% of daylight hours.
